Belarusian volunteer fighter Aŭdziej dies in Ukraine

(Belarusian Volunteer Corps)
May 18, Pozirk. Belarusian volunteer fighter Alaksiej Aŭdziej, call sign Ryžy, has been killed in action in Ukraine, the Belarusian Volunteer Corps (BVC) said on Telegram.
This is the death he longed for, the BVC said, describing him as eccentric, sincere and unstoppable.
Aŭdziej, 26, was on a combat mission in the Kupiansk area.
The native of Belarus’ Kleck district participated in the post-election protests in 2020, was jailed and later emigrated.
When Russia attempted to occupy the whole of Ukraine, Aŭdziej joined the Kastuś Kalinoŭski Regiment, but later was transferred to the BVC.
According to media reports, at least 65 Belarusian volunteers have died in battles against Russia since the start of the full-scale war.
